Hike to the top of Murchison Falls where the Nile squeezes through a 7-meter gorge, creating the world's most powerful waterfall.
Explore the northern bank for elephants, giraffes, buffalo, lions, and leopards across vast savanna landscapes.
Cruise up the Nile to the base of the falls. See hippos, crocodiles, and abundant birdlife along the riverbanks.
